HAVING written to the Prime Minister, the Chancellor, John Patten (who is my MP), Baroness Chalker and the leaders of the two main opposition parties with regard to the Treasury's previous and insensitive proposal to reduce the British overseas aid budget by up to 15 per cent, I now wish to declare publicly my deep sense of shame over the fact that our Government could countenance such a heartless measure while up to 40 million people face the grim prospects of drought, famine and epidemic disease in East Africa and elsewhere.
